Osun state Governor, Gboyega Oyetola has announced the appointment of Mr. Adeniyi Adesina as his Chief Press Secretary (CPS). According to a statement, the appointment takes immediate effect.
Until his current appointment, Adesina was The Nation’s Deputy Editor in charge of News.
As CPS, he will oversee and coordinate the governor’s strategic communication and media matters. He will also project an effective interface between the Governor, the media and all segments of the state’s citizenry.
Adesina’s 28-year career in journalism has seen him work with leading titles such as Prime People (1990 -1992), National Concord (1993-1999), Punch (2000-2006), News Star as Editor (2007-2009), from where he joined The Nation in 2010.
He holds a Master’s degree in Mass Communication from the University of Lagos. He has also undergone further media training in the United Kingdom and Denmark.
